The Journey Continues: Thankful

Sunday, November 24, 2019

My journey found me asking friends to share what they are thankful for this Sunday before Thanksgiving.

Ross King, president and owner of King Feed Co. Inc. and real estate broker: “I have so much to be thankful for as I was raised in an active and loving Christian family here in San Marcos. I became a follower of Jesus Christ at age 14. I am thankful and blessed with my beautiful wife, Martha, four beautiful daughters and their families, nine grandchildren and 12 great-grandchildren. All are believers in Christ. I am thankful for an abundance of friends, good health and a fulfilling retirement."

Linda Coker, community volunteer: “Of course, I am thankful for my remarkably amazing grandkids, husband and family. But right now, I am so thankful that I finally realize, without a doubt, that no matter what is happening, God, the light, universe, whatever you choose to call it, has my back and regardless of what is happening it truly is going to be OK.”

George Gilbert, Business owner and long-time Lions Club member: “What I am most thankful for? Having been born and raised in a Christian family with three brothers and three sisters, where I enjoyed excellent health with plenty of love and compassion. Living in a country where you could worship God whenever and wherever you pleased. For my 63 years of marriage with Bobbie and three wonderful kids — Gary, James and Gaye Lynn — plus five grandkids and four great-grandkids.”

Trini Rodriguez, licensed professional counselor and private therapist: “First, I am so thankful for my three children, who I realized this year have grown up and are wonderful people. They are my heroes! A quote from my book,' Trini My Life of Poems,' ‘For they turned on the color, Onto a black and white canvas. For I was painted on a wall, Without breath or meaning.’ Second, I am thankful for my new-found church, where I have found friends and songs that rekindle my faith. Sermons from Pastor Chad that direct and confirm my work. And my Bible study group that feeds my faith. I am so thankful.”

Ron Wilson, CPA: “As with others in the 80+ age group, I have seen many years of changes in our world, but I continue to value most the bedrocks of God and country upon which our nation was founded. My family, God’s word and grace, First Baptist Church, America, friends, health and work. These are the blessing for which I thank God every day.”

Phil Walker, artisan and church leader at Redwood Baptist Church: “I am thankful for God turning my life around and bringing me to Christ; now I just live for Christ. I am thankful for my family and my church family. I minister to homeless people at mealtime at Southside Community Center by giving them encouraging ‘God Bless Cards’ on which I handprint a scripture verse. It blesses me when a person says, ‘I was having a bad day, but I read the scripture on the card and it made my day.’ I am thankful for a wonderful Bible study on Wednesday and Thursday nights at Redwood church, so we can ‘be granted understanding of what we read.'”

“Give thanks in all circumstances, for this is God’s will for you in Christ Jesus.” I Thessalonians 5:18

“Always giving thanks to God the Father for everything. In the name of our Lord Jesus Christ.” Ephesians 5:20
